The Fulton Georgia Employment Agreement encompasses various important aspects, including job title and description, compensation and benefits, working hours, performance expectations, and termination policies. By clearly defining these crucial details, the agreement aims to establish clarity and transparency between the employer and the employee. Different types of Fulton Georgia Employment Agreements can be categorized based on their duration and nature. These may include: 1. Fixed-Term Employment Agreement: This type of agreement specifies a predetermined end date or a specific duration within which the employee will work for the employer. It clearly outlines the terms, conditions, and expectations for the agreed-upon duration. 2. Indefinite Employment Agreement: In contrast to a fixed-term agreement, this type of agreement does not have a specific end date. It establishes an ongoing employment relationship until either party decides to terminate it, subject to the termination policies outlined in the agreement. 3. Part-Time Employment Agreement: This agreement is applicable when an employee is hired to work less than full-time hours, typically with a reduced salary and benefits compared to a full-time position. It outlines the specific working hours, compensation, and expectations for a part-time employee. 4. Probationary Employment Agreement: This agreement is commonly used when an employer wants to evaluate an employee's performance and suitability for a particular role before offering a permanent position. It sets forth the probationary period, during which the employee's performance is assessed, and the terms for possible continuation of employment thereafter. It is worth noting that the specific terms and conditions of a Fulton Georgia Employment Agreement may vary based on the nature of the work, industry standards, and any applicable local, state, or federal laws. Furthermore, it is crucial for both employers and employees to carefully review, understand, and comply with the terms laid out in the agreement to ensure a harmonious and legally compliant working relationship in Fulton County, Georgia.
